In this compelling episode of 'Stop Child Abuse Now', the focus is on raising awareness and offering support to survivors of child abuse. The show, hosted by Annie and joined by special guest Victoria Kelly, explores the multifaceted issues surrounding child abuse and its long-lasting impact on survivors. Victoria, a dedicated volunteer and survivor professional with the National Association of Adult Survivors of Child Abuse (NASCA), shares her harrowing yet inspiring journey.
Her life has been marked by diverse abuses, including severe institutional abuse, yet she has emerged as a beacon of hope for others. Victoria discusses her role as the Founder and Managing Director of 'A Helping Hand for Healing Souls (AHHS)', an organization that provides vital resources and support for women and children affected by abuse. She regularly organizes support groups, rallies, and conferences, and works with law enforcement and shelters to address the urgent needs of survivors.
Her story is a testament to resilience, as she describes overcoming addiction and mental health challenges through proper therapy and community support. The episode emphasizes the importance of breaking the taboo surrounding childhood sexual abuse (CSA) and the necessity of public education to address this global issue. NASCA's mission is highlighted, focusing on providing hope and healing paths for adult survivors through various services.
